Key findings

  • China recorded 24,455 port calls in August 2026, an increase of 7.8% from 22,696 calls in July 2026.
  • Bulk Carrier remained the largest vessel type category at 6,505 calls, a 26.6% share, up 7.6% from July, while Other (incl. offshore) posted the largest real vessel-type increase, rising 29.1% to 2,617 calls, and Container declined 6.8% to 5,378 calls.
  • Shanghai led all ports with 2,227 calls, a 9.1% share, followed by Tianjin with 1,329 calls and Zhoushan with 1,218 calls, together accounting for 19.5% of national port calls.
